Smart TV Stand Choices

First, think about what you actually need under the screen. Do you have a pile of games, magazines, or remote‑control clutter? A low‑profile console with built‑in shelves can hide those items and keep the floor clear. Look for sturdy wood or metal frames – they last longer than cheap particleboard. If your room feels cramped, a wall‑mounted floating stand frees up floor space and adds a modern touch. Measure your TV width and leave at least two inches on each side so the stand looks balanced.

Another trick is to use the TV stand as a mini media hub. Choose a model with cable management holes, so you can route wires neatly and avoid a tangled mess. Adding a couple of decorative boxes or baskets on top gives you extra storage without breaking the clean lines. The key is to pick something that matches your décor, whether that’s a sleek black metal look or a warm oak finish.

Choosing Sofas and Chairs that Last

When it comes to sofas, durability beats trend. Test the frame by pressing on the armrest – a solid wood or metal frame won’t wobble. Look for cushions with high‑density foam wrapped in a layer of down or a supportive fiber. These stay firm for years and are easier to clean. If you love a soft feel, pick a removable cover that you can wash. That way spills don’t ruin your favorite piece.

For chairs, especially if you have an office or study corner, ergonomic design matters. A chair with lumbar support and adjustable height helps you stay comfortable during long reading sessions. Choose fabrics that breathe – linen or cotton blends keep you cool, while leather adds a touch of luxury but needs regular care. And don’t forget the legs: sturdy wooden legs or metal casters keep the chair stable and mobile.
